Transaction 41e15834aba72805ed5fe50f68aad75cd69bdae3574e2d063cee308c2ceb17e4
1 Input
2 Outputs
- 41e15834aba72805ed5fe50f68aad75cd69bdae3574e2d063cee308c2ceb17e4:0
- 41e15834aba72805ed5fe50f68aad75cd69bdae3574e2d063cee308c2ceb17e4:1
value 2980224
address 38VLkqT5rGCGf5YkzYYjdn6JsDTNBHwHsu
value 1019104
address 1HjNRSTodJoRBJfdL4QVRbiVBYr4kSZCgy